Output d3052b9a76b92300a774364061a65e199707803f0d4123cd28372a9eff03bb22:40

value
329433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f357a3d6b8e4ad98ec3e7dfe8968dddd7f4d12 OP_EQUAL
address
3DSqvpYRVSV5hsEFyCMzDQmBNxJVYwCQdy
transaction
d3052b9a76b92300a774364061a65e199707803f0d4123cd28372a9eff03bb22
spent
true